181 BISHOPSFIELD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Harlow local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 181 BISHOPSFIELD sales from August 2004 and September 2007 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the August 2004 sale was for 58%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 58% below the HPI over time, until the September 2007 sale, where it rises to 56%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 56% below the HPI.

What might 181 BISHOPSFIELD be worth now?

181 BISHOPSFIELD might now be worth an estimated £265,864.

This is based on house price inflation of 73.8%, between September 2007 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Harlow local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 73.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 181 BISHOPSFIELD of £153,000 on 7th September 2007. For the value to have increased from £153,000 to £265,864 over the eighteen years and seven months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 181 BISHOPSFIELD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Harlow local authority area.
  • The September 2007 sale price of £153,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 181 BISHOPSFIELD has not materially changed since September 2007.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
